Join us for a unique screening of this powerful, award-winning documentary from Palestinian-British journalist Yousef Alhelou showing rare footage of Gaza’s beauty, culture and people, filmed just weeks before the genocide began.
The film will be followed by a Q&A with the director and a chance to sample his homemade falafel sandwiches.
Yousef visited Gaza in the summer of 2023 to reconnect with the city of his birth, meet his large family and promote Gaza to the outside world as a resilient and vibrant place.
Today, two and a half years into Israel's war of annihilation, this remarkable film stands as a celebration of life and an archive capturing memories of an obliterated land.
It rehumanises the people who live there and represents a piece of enduring heritage.
The film has already won 22 awards including for Best Documentary and Best Director at 5 international film festivals.
Renowned broadcast journalist and film maker Yousef will join us in Hastings for the screening; a journey through rare, breathtaking footage of a vibrant Gaza now lost to history - its historic buildings, bustling markets, serene beaches, olive groves, resorts, and joyful social ceremonies.
His intimate record, captured just before its destruction, has become a priceless archive of a world under siege, showcasing the creativity and resilience of a people who “decorated their prison” and defied collective punishment.
The film transforms into a moving eulogy and a testament to the unbreakable will of the Palestinian people. “The Phoenix of Gaza” is a tragic yet hopeful glimpse of a society that, despite immense suffering, refuses to be extinguished.
